Stadol or Lidocaine
« on: Jan 2nd, 2003, 3:23pm »
Quote Quote Modify Modify Remove Remove

Has anyone had any luck with Stadol NS or Lidocain 4% solution nose drops.  I did have a little luck with Lidocaine many years ago but I remeber getting it in the right spot to abort a headache was hit and miss at best.  I tried Stadol NS but don't remeber if it gave me any relief.  
 
I on my way to my doc and need to get ANYTHING that will help these headaches.

I have tried the stadol nasal spray.  It numbed the pain for me, however it made me very naseaus and I could not go to sleep until 6 in the morning.  I had a stadol shot from urgent care once and it worked much better, however it also kept me awake.
 
My personal opinion is that it was no better than suffering through the cluster attack. Angry  I tried this before the doc prescribed maxalt and oxygen.  The maxalt works every time for me.
 
Summation - I have a 60.00 bottle of stadol that I will not be using again. ;D

My spouse is a sufferer.  He has taken Stadol for about 5 years & it the only thing thus far that he has found to relieve the pain.  It makes him sleepy & wiped out, but it does kill the pain.  However, after using it during his last cycle which ended in January, his eyes have been left being very light sensitive.  But, he said he would still use the Stadol, despite his eye problem.
